## Pool exhaustion: quick fix

Plugins hitting Dunmore's pool must not hold connections across callbacks. If you see checkout timeouts, your plugin is likely leaking handles. Release in a finally block, always. Tune nothing yourself; the host owns pool sizing. For reference, the host applies the pool settings shown below.

settings of fafog-haduf:
ZORIX_PIN=4648
ZORIX_METRICS_HOST=metrics.zorix.paliqsys.corp
ZORIX_LOG_LEVEL=info
ZORIX_TENANT=druix

Recovery runbook, Ospreyline API. Context: the GraphQL N+1 fix batches author lookups via the new dataloader in resolvers/posts. If an account gets wedged mid-recovery, re-run the recovery flow — it's idempotent now thanks to that batching change. Don't touch the legacy resolver; it's gone next sprint. To authorize a manual account recovery, enter the recovery passphrase below.

recovery phrase for fahif-hadup: sorix-holael

## Local Setup — Drift Calibration

Welcome aboard. The Verdanta greenhouse controller compensates for sensor drift by comparing each humidity and temperature probe against a rolling seven-day baseline stored locally. For development, seed the baseline tables with the fixture script in tools/seed_drift.py, otherwise the compensator rejects all readings as out-of-range. Run the script once after cloning, then start the controller in sim mode. The script expects the calibration database to be reachable via the connection string below.

replica DSN, yahog-kawig: redis://istox_svc:um@db-8a67.halixforge.test:5432/frawyn

# DocSentry Environments

This page describes the environments our documentation linter runs in, for reviewers checking lint-rule changes. Local runs use the bundled rule set and skip link validation; CI runs the full set against the Harwick style guide, so discrepancies between the two usually mean a rule is gated by environment. Always review lint diffs against CI output, not local. The CI environment runs the linter with the following configuration values.

settings of bawif-fawif:
ralix:
  log_level: warn
  metrics_host: metrics.ralix.tolvaqsys.internal
  pool_size: 32